Tesla CEO Elon Musk said while Bitcoin mining is steadily becoming more environmentally friendly through the use of renewable energy, he is not yet sure that it’s enough for Tesla to resume accepting the cryptocurrency as payment for purchases. Neon Labs, a firm focused on secure blockchain technology, announced today that it will be deploying a cross-chain Ethereum virtual machine on the Solana testnet. U.S. crypto lending platform BlockFi has been ordered by the New Jersey Bureau of Securities to stop accepting new customers who are based in New Jersey for its interest-bearing accounts due to alleged violations of securities laws.
